Secret Service’s $400 Million Crypto Cache: A Decade Of Digital Hunts

  • The US Secret Service has accumulated nearly $400 million in a cold wallet over the past 10 years through seizing coins from various fraud cases and tracking transactions on the blockchain.
  • The agency's Global Investigative Operations Center used open-source tools and thorough investigations to trace scam proceeds and freeze funds in cold storage wallets linked to illicit activities.
  • The Secret Service launched a global crackdown on crypto scams, seizing over $400 million and collaborating with 60+ countries and major exchanges to combat rug pulls, phishing schemes, and stolen crypto.
  • Crypto fraud now ranks as one of the top internet crime losses in the US, with Americans reporting $9.3 billion stolen in crypto scams in 2024. Law enforcement agencies worldwide are receiving training to detect and shut down crypto-related schemes more effectively.
